Poolside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Poolside hardscaping services encompass the design and installation of durable, attractive surfaces and features around a swimming pool area. This includes constructing patios, walkways, retaining walls, fire pits, seating areas, and other hardscape elements that enhance both the functionality and aesthetic appeal of the pool environment. Projects typically involve selecting suitable materials such as pavers, stone, concrete, or brick to create a safe, slip-resistant surface that complements the overall landscape. Property owners often seek these services to improve outdoor living spaces, increase property value, and create a welcoming area for relaxation and entertainment.
Before requesting poolside hardscaping, homeowners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the space, preferred materials, and the overall style of the backyard. It’s also helpful to think about drainage, safety features, and how the new hardscape will integrate with existing landscaping. Clarifying project goals and desired features can assist in planning a functional, visually appealing outdoor area that meets specific needs and complements the surrounding environment.

Poolside Hardscaping Questions
What types of hardscaping are common around pools? Typical features include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and fire pits designed to complement pool areas.
How can hardscaping improve a pool area? It creates functional, attractive spaces for lounging, dining, and entertainment while enhancing safety and accessibility.
What materials are suitable for poolside hardscaping? Common options include natural stone, concrete pavers, brick, and stamped concrete, chosen for durability and style.
Are there design considerations for poolside hardscaping? Yes, considerations include slip resistance, drainage, and harmonizing with the landscape for a cohesive look.
